Bernie Sanders is an American 🏷️#politician who has served as the junior United States senator from Vermont since 2007. Prior to his Senate career, he was the mayor of 📝Burlington, VT from 1981 to 1989 and a member of the U.S. House of Representatives from 1991 to 2007. Sanders is best known as an independent lawmaker aligned with progressive policies, although he caucuses with the Democratic Party. He has been a prominent advocate for democratic socialism, emphasizing issues such as universal healthcare, free public college tuition, and reducing income inequality. Sanders ran for the Democratic presidential nomination in both 2016 and 2020, shaping national discourse by pushing progressive policies into mainstream debate. His legislative record includes support for veterans’ benefits, opposition to foreign wars such as the Iraq conflict, and advocacy for labor rights. A consistent critic of corporate influence in politics, he has also focused on climate change and campaign finance reform. His career reflects a long-standing commitment to grassroots organizing and social justice causes across several decades of public service.
